准确理解分类器性能在多种场景中至关重要。然而,现有文献常仅依赖一两个标准评分来比较分类器,难以捕捉特定应用的需求细节。近期提出的Tile是一种可视化工具,可将无穷多的排序指标组织成二维地图。借助Tile,能够高效比较分类器,展现所有可能的应用偏好,而无需依赖一对评分。本文以四位典型用户(理论分析者、方法设计者、基准测试者、应用开发者)为例,介绍适配其需求的多种解释性呈现方式,并通过四个场景对74个前沿语义分割模型进行排名与分析。结果表明,Tile能在单一可视化中有效捕捉分类器行为,同时兼容无限多的排序指标。配套代码已提供于补充材料。

Properly understanding the performances of classifiers is essential in various scenarios. However, the literature often relies only on one or two standard scores to compare classifiers, which fails to capture the nuances of application-specific requirements. The Tile is a recently introduced visualization tool organizing an infinity of ranking scores into a 2D map. Thanks to the Tile, it is now possible to compare classifiers efficiently, displaying all possible application-specific preferences instead of having to rely on a pair of scores. This hitchhiker's guide to understanding the performances of two-class classifiers presents four scenarios showcasing different user profiles: a theoretical analyst, a method designer, a benchmarker, and an application developer. We introduce several interpretative flavors adapted to the user's needs by mapping different values on the Tile. We illustrate this guide by ranking and analyzing the performances of 74 state-of-the-art semantic segmentation models through the perspective of the four scenarios. Through these user profiles, we demonstrate that the Tile effectively captures the behavior of classifiers in a single visualization, while accommodating an infinite number of ranking scores. Code for mapping the different Tile flavors is available in supplementary material.
